P.R. Professor Wins Award

Professor Kirk HazlettProf. Kirk Hazlett was honored Nov. 13 with the "Boston Beacon Award" by the Boston chapter of Public Relations Society of America.  The award honors lifetime achievement in the profession of public relations.

"I'm honored to be recognized for my contributions," said Prof. Hazlett.  "I feel there are many others that are much more deserving but I truly appreciate the recognition from my peers."

P.R. professionals from all over greater Boston were on hand to congratulate Prof. Hazlett on this milestone.  The event was held at the Fairmont Copley Plaza hotel in Boston.

Students from Curry's student chapter of PRSA were also on hand at the ceremony to cheer Prof. Hazlett on.  Prof. Hazlett's Communication faculty colleagues were excited by the news.

"This is a testament to Kirk's professionalism and dedication," said Prof. Jerry Gibbs.  "The award is a culmination of many things, and our students are the biggest winners because they reap the benefits of his experiences everyday in the classroom."

Prof. Hazlett is an Assistant Professor at Curry College where he oversees the growing Public Relations concentration.  He is also the past-president of PRSA.
